BofA Reaffirms Air Liquide at Buy Amid Reports of Elliott Management Stake

By

BofA Global Research on Wednesday reiterated its buy rating on Air Liquide (AI.PA) amid chatter that Elliott Management built a stake in the French industrial gas group.

The Financial Times recently reported, citing people familiar with the matter, that the activist hedge fund engaged with Air Liquide in recent weeks after building its shareholding. Meanwhile, sources told Reuters that Elliott is reportedly pushing for improvements to make the group more competitive in the industrial gases industry.

"Neither the size of the position nor Elliott's specific demands were disclosed. Air Liquide nevertheless appears an unusual activist target, in our view: (1) Near record share price, (2) elevated 67% P/E premium to the market (SXXP), (3) Record EUR6b order backlog, supercharged by a drumbeat of recent Electronics wins. The reported move by Elliott comes around 4 weeks before Air Liquide's CMD to 2030, where we expect a focus on organic growth, particularly Electronics, margin targets and possibly some light on capital allocation priorities," the research firm said, noting that talks between the two entities were reportedly centered on narrowing the margin gap with industry peer Linde (LIN.F).

The price objective for Air Liquide's stock stands at 200 euros.

BW LPG Launches Offering of $300 Million Convertible Bonds Due 2031

BW LPG (BWLPG.OL) commenced an offering of $300 million in senior unsecured convertible bonds due Sept. 9, 2031, on Tuesday, according to a same-day release.Scheduled for issuance and settlement on Sept. 9, 2026, the bonds are expected to have an annual coupon rate between 2% and 2.50%, with the initial conversion price at a premium in the 35% to 40% range above the share reference price, subject to customary adjustments.The final terms will be determined after the accelerated bookbuild process. The liquefied petroleum gas vessel owner and operator will have the option to redeem a portion or all of the bonds after Sept. 30, 2029.Net proceeds from the offering will be used to partially finance the construction of eight Panamax very large gas carriers with Hyundai Heavy Industries and for general corporate expenditures.

Methanex to Idle New Zealand Plants in Q1 2027 After Gas Contract Sale

Methanex (MEOH) said Tuesday it has agreed to sell substantially all of its New Zealand natural gas contractual entitlements, effective the first quarter of 2027 through the end of the decade.As a result, Methanex expects to indefinitely idle its New Zealand production facilities in the first quarter of 2027, the company said.The company cited continued decline in domestic natural gas availability and a lack of clear pathway to new supply, adding that it does not expect material cash costs from the decision, and any updates to production or financial guidance will be released with its regular quarterly communications.
